Unlocking Blocked Websites with VPN Services

Are you looking for a way to access blocked websites? VPN services are a great way to do this. A Virtual Private Network (VPN) is a secure connection between two or more devices that allows users to access the internet without being tracked or monitored. It is often used by businesses and individuals to protect their data and privacy online. With a VPN, you can access websites that are blocked in your country or region, as well as websites that are blocked by your ISP or other organizations.

Using a VPN is easy and straightforward. All you need to do is download and install the software on your device, then connect to the VPN server of your choice. Once connected, you can browse the internet as if you were in another country or region. This means that you can access websites that are blocked in your country or region, as well as websites that are blocked by your ISP or other organizations.

When using a VPN, it is important to choose a reliable provider. There are many different providers available, so it is important to do your research and find one that offers good speeds, security, and privacy features. Additionally, make sure that the provider has servers located in the countries or regions where you want to access blocked websites.
